Sioux Tempestt

Biography

Sioux Tempestt is a Perth artist with a graphic design background who produces paintings, digital works, murals and public art. Tempestt has been involved in numerous group shows and held seven solo exhibitions. Among other achievements Tempestt was a Finalist, City of Busselton Art Award, 2018; Highly Commended, City of South Perth Emerging Artist Award 2018; Highly Commended, Town of Bassendean Visual Art Award 2018; Finalist, City of Joondalup 2018 Community Invitation Art Award. Tempestt has produced many mural, community and ephemeral public artworks over the years, working with local governments and town teams. She enjoys the community engagement aspect of running creative workshops, particularly with youth.

Artist Statement

Sioux Tempestt constantly pushes the boundaries of her practice by traversing across different mediums and scale of works. Tempestt’s artworks intuitively fuse colour and form to investigate the integration of abstract expressionism with the urban environment.
